Bing Translator is another big name when it comes to translators. This translator makes use of the Microsoft Translator. You can either manually select the language that you are putting as the input or wait for the site to detect it automatically.

    Apertium is one of them. We make open-source rule-based machine translation systems, and our core tools are in C++. A few of our proposed ideas involve modifying those C++ tools with new features or improvements to existing features. Source: about 3 years ago
